Output 6662aed13f11452c995ad0b028966a4b854af58aa306f433e44739090b356b7a: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c3b8eb218bdceb0afc240e69cb3b38659e77c42 OP_EQUALVERIFY OP_CHECKSIG
address
16VUtdbFyh9kogGTFxAof2rSz69q4VLDu8
transaction
6662aed13f11452c995ad0b028966a4b854af58aa306f433e44739090b356b7a
spent
true